Answer customer questions with AI, for retail stores
Customer messages about returns, sizes, and tracking pile up while you're trying to run the shop floor. Hand the questions to AI to draft warm replies based on your store rules, then check them and send.
What to gather first
- Your store return and exchange policy
- A sizing chart or brand fit notes
- Three customer messages from today
- Two friendly replies you wrote before
Which app
For this one, a plain AI chat window is enough. Open the chat, paste what you gathered, and type the message below.
How to do it
- Paste your store rules first. Put your return policy, shipping notes, and size charts into the chat. Tell AI to read them as the single source of truth for the shop. AI holds these details ready for the questions you add next.
- Add past replies as tone examples. Copy in two notes you sent to shoppers recently. This shows AI how you sound when you speak to your customers. AI matches your voice instead of writing stiff corporate paragraphs.
- Paste the customer questions. Drop in the messages from your inbox or social chat. AI reads the customer's issue and drafts an answer using your policy text. You get a separate draft for each shopper.
- Read and fix the drafts. Look through every reply for the right tone and proper dates. Edit anything that sounds off or adjust details for special customer situations. Copy the text into your email or direct message and hit send.
What to type first
I run a retail shop. Here are my store policies, sizing notes, and two emails I wrote earlier so you know my tone. Read the three customer questions pasted below and draft a reply for each one using only my store rules. Keep the tone friendly and plain. Do not send anything or make up policies.
Change the words to match your business. AI follows what you say, so say what done looks like.
Before you trust it
- Check that return window days and shipping rules match your actual store policy.
- Make sure the sizing advice points to the exact measurements you provided.
- Confirm your tone sounds like you are talking across the shop counter.
